Martha Kearney is now interviewing Liz Truss, the foreign secretary, on the Today programme now.
They start with Ukraine. Truss says the UK has ruled nothing out in terms of the sanctions it might impose on Russia in the event of an invasion. Sanctions would cover financial institutions and individuals, she says.
